The Itinerary Breakdown
Departure from Sorrento
The journey begins with setting sail from Sorrento, a town famous for its cliffs and sweeping views. We loved the way the boat glided smoothly away from land, giving a fresh perspective on the area’s rugged coastline.
Roman Villa & Punta Campanella
Soon after departure, you’ll get a glimpse of ancient history—a Roman villa remains that tell stories of past civilizations. The Punta Campanella lighthouse marks the tip of the Sorrento Peninsula, offering panoramic views of Capri and the coastline. This spot is especially magical as the sky meets the sea in a seamless dance of blue, making it an ideal photo stop.
Li Galli Archipelago and Swim Stop
Next, the boat heads toward Li Galli, a tiny archipelago with legendary allure. According to legend, Sirens once inhabited these waters, enchanting sailors like Ulysses. Here, you’ll have your first chance to take a swim in crystal-clear waters—an experience many reviews highlight as a favorite. The waters are known for their clarity and tranquility, perfect for unwinding after a few hours at sea.
From Sea to Town: Amalfi
Following the swim, the boat offers a scenic view of Amalfi, with its dramatic cliffs and historic charm. The boat drops anchor for about an hour to explore this seaside city’s famous Cathedral—a stunning example of medieval architecture with a commanding staircase. You’ll have time to stroll through narrow streets, soak in the atmosphere, and perhaps indulge in a quick coffee or pastry at a local spot.
You also get to enjoy a visit to Pansa pastry shop, where you can sample traditional sweets—adding a tasty touch to your journey.
Positano: The Vertical Village
Next, the boat arrives at the vibrant town of Positano, often called the “vertical village” because of its houses clinging to steep cliffs. The approximately 2-hour stop gives you ample time to wander its narrow, flower-lined streets, browse artisan boutiques, or relax on its beaches like Spiaggia Grande or Fornillo.
Many visitors mention how Positano feels like a living postcard, with colorful houses, art galleries, and artisan workshops. You can even watch skilled shoemakers craft custom sandals or admire local fabrics—charming details that make Positano more than just a photo op.
Return Journey and Sunset Views
As the day winds down, the boat heads back toward Sorrento, with the setting sun casting warm orange hues over the coast. This is often cited as one of the most stunning moments of the trip—watching the coast turn fiery as you glide along, capturing perfect photos and savoring the last moments of your private adventure.
